## Local Setup

GridWeaver is our crossword generator, and honestly it's pretty painless to run locally. Clone the repo, install deps with `make bootstrap`, and seed the word list from the fixtures folder. The puzzle solver needs at least 2GB of RAM, so bump your container limits if grids hang. Once that's done, point the app at the clue database using the value below.

primary connection of kajop-yahap = postgresql://pelax_svc:EQ@db-49fe.tolvaqgrid.example:5432/zormir

Brushclear runs nightly against the Fernwald monorepo and deletes branches with no commits in 120 days, excluding anything matching the protected-pattern list in its config. For this security review, note that the bot operates with repository-admin scope, which is broader than strictly required; a scoped-token migration is tracked separately. Brushclear authenticates to the internal Gitmarshal API with a long-lived credential injected at deploy time. The Gitmarshal service key is shown immediately below.

app token of kajop-tahag = qvz23-qaEp6MzrfP2AwhVbZwsZeUq

Heads up, support folks: if customers report delayed alerts from Pingwhistle, it's probably notification fan-out backpressure again. The dispatcher queues up fine, but when a workspace has 500+ subscribers, the fan-out worker throttles itself and events pile up behind the retry gate. Restarting the worker pool usually clears it within a minute. Before escalating to the Birchtown infra team, grab the trace token from the stuck build below.

pipeline stamp: htk3_69f

CI troubleshooting note — Sproutline watering scheduler

The flaky failures in the schedule-generation suite trace back to the test harness seeding the moisture simulator with wall-clock time, so runs near midnight crossed a day boundary and produced off-by-one watering windows. We froze the simulated clock in fixtures and added an explicit boundary-crossing test. If you see similar failures, check the fixture clock first before suspecting the solver. The corrected pipeline first went green on the build below.

pipeline stamp: htk9_6ce9d33c5